Star Robert Downey Jr. was injured today on the set of Iron Man 3, which has caused the film to temporarily halt production.
"Robert Downey Jr. sustained an ankle injury on the set of Iron Man 3 in Wilmington, North Carolina while performing a stunt. There will be a short delay in the production schedule while he recuperates," said Marvel Studios in a statement.
